Arab won the last time they faced Guntersville, and things went their way on Thursday too. The Arab Knights came out on top in a nail-biter against the Guntersville Wildcats , sneaking past 3-2. Winning may never get old, but the Knights sure are getting used to it with their fourth in a row.
Arab wouldn't go down easily and took Guntersville into a fifth set where they got it done with a seven-point win. The match finished with set scores of 23-25, 25-23, 25-21, 17-25, 15-8.
Among those leading the charge was Kayden Gronczniak, who had 22 digs. She is on a roll when it comes to digs, as she's now had 11 or more in the last five games she's played dating back to last season.
Arab is on a roll lately: they've won 12 of their last 14 contests, which provided a nice bump to their 39-14 record this season. As for Guntersville, their loss dropped their record down to 50-12.
